Bonjour,
Joe did some paperwork at the house this morning. Then, he headed into town with Dan. They had been looking for one more ceiling fan for the church that was the same as the ones that were already there. They were able to find a fan. They spent the rest of the morning trying to get the Coke crate refilled for the Watchnight Service. They had to start buying them one bottle at a time and finally got the crate filled back up.
The Luthers will return in a couple weeks. Joe is working on getting things ready for their return. He went to get a car battery for their vehicle. Then, he worked on cleaning out their water tank. A squirrel had gotten inside the tank and died. So, it had to be scrubbed and disinfected.
The kids helped Joe clean out the pool this afternoon after naps.
I made pizza for supper. I am still not feeling very well with this sinus infection. Joe did the dishes for me, what a sweetheart!
Bonnie seems to have an ear infection now. Maybe one of these days we will all be healthy!
